ALTHOUGH Roger and Patsy are only now a formal partnership, both Roger and Patsy have been using the same bloodlines for over forty years. Patsy started along with her first husband with a small fawn bitch called Lowglen Micant Madonna, who won 1 CC and several reserves. Roger's first was Laguna Lyre sired by Ch Laguna Light Lagoon, he was exported to Italy. Roger's second Whippet was Ch Courthill Dondelayo Tiara and she is behind every subsequent Courthill. Patsy's first champion was Ch Lowglen Newbold Cavalier who was a trememdous influence on Whippets, in fact Tiara was mated to Cavalier to produced Courthill Crown Jewel, who won BP at Crufts and then exported to Switzerland. Roger's first home-bred Champion was Courthill Coromet who was out of a daughter of Tiara mated to Laguna bred dog at Shalfleet. Patsy's first champion bitch was Ch Lowglen Holly Go Lightly who was by Roger's Dondelayo Repetition, sister to Tiara and Duette (RBIS at Crufts). Roger then couldn't have dogs for ten years and Barbara Wilton-Clark kept his line going so he could come back into Whippets with his original lines intact, his first bitch was Crown Affair of C when mated to Ch Pencloe Dutch Gold produced two champion sisters, Crown of Gold and Classical Jazz, which Roger's thinks are his best Whippets to date. A sister went to Bob Bailey's Fullerton kennel and produced three champion sisters. Meanwhile Patsy bought in Ch Novacroft Madrigal as a puppy and his influence in seen all round the world. When Patsy remarried she had to start again but produced many more champions especially seeing the potential in puppies by her boy's. Patsy has always had a strong kennel of champions boys and much prefers boys to girls. Patsy was lucky to have Ch / Int Ch Rivarco Classical Jazz to come to stay and live with her and her other import is Ch Sporting Field's Winged Dove.
